
General Miguna Miguna has given words of wisdom to Aisha Jumwa and Orange Democratic Party Secretary Edwin Sifuna following their burial drama.
Dr. Miguna has cautioned them from invoking the names of their respective ethnicity in political contests advising them to speak as Kenyans.
“Being a Mijikenda or Luhya have nothing to do with the one-main authoritarianism in ODM,” Miguna stated.

Mourners attending the funeral of Mombasa Deputy Governor William Kingi’s father were on Friday left in shock after Malindi MP Aisha Jumwa barred ODM secretary-general Edwin Sifuna from addressing mourners.
As Mr. Sifuna began to speak, Ms. Jumwa, who was the master of ceremonies, walked to the stage and grabbed the microphone from him, accusing him of “talking politics during the funeral”.

“We shall not allow this; respect the Mijikenda. Find another platform and speak about issues relating to ODM. We are here to mourn the dead and not politics,” she said as the crowd shouted, some voicing support and others jeering her.
